The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John McKersey, born in 1833 in Dundee, Forfarshire (Angus), consisted of 8 members. John was the head of the household, married to Jane McKersey, born in 1834 in Buteshire, Scotland. They had 6 children; Barbara (born 1857 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Jane (born 1859 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Peter (born 1866 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Charles (born 1872 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Andrew (born 1875 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and Jessie (born 1869 in Govan, Lanarkshire, Scotland).
